追加のストレージスペースを配置するには? [閉鎖]

追加のストレージスペースを配置するには? [閉鎖]

デュアルブートを行うと、追加のストレージスペースはすべて/win/d、/win/e、/win/f...にあり、NTFSでフォーマットされます。

デスクトップは仮想マシンでのみWindowsを実行しており、Sambaはすべてのパーティション(デスクトップを除く)にアクセスします。

私は物事を整理する方法について完全に混乱しています。

複数のユーザーがアクセスできる追加のHDスペースをどのように配置しますか?私はさまざまな用途にさまざまなアカウントを使用しています。つまり、ペルソナです。複数の人がアクセスしたい場合は、すべて/ homeにいることはできませんか?

また、映画、書籍、音楽、コンピュータに書かれたスクリプト、ソフトウェアプロジェクト、パッケージシステムの外部で生成されたソフトウェア(私は別々に保管することを好む)など、さまざまなデータをどのように構成しますか?

答え1

実際に役立つものを見つけてくださいあなた最高の選択です。私は/dataいつも/storage私の気分に応じて新しいマウントポイントを作成します。必要だと思いますが、ちょうど台無しにする非一時的なデータは、/home/共有データとともにそこに移動されます。

データを整理する方法は次のとおりです。

/storage/movies/<big pile-o-moviex
/storage/music/artist/album
/storage/projects/<language>/project
/storage/<logical_category>/<logical_segmentation>

答え2

私はデータを2つの中央フォルダに分割するのが好きです。 1つ(通常は/ヒープと呼ばれます)には、バックアップする必要のない回復可能なデータが含まれており(すべては中央サーバーからコピーされます)、もう1つは(私は/ dataを使用しています)。これにより、バックアップしているディレクトリのリストを持っているよりも、自動的にマシンをバックアップする方が簡単になります。

これは、Zypherが提案したようにデータを設定から分離し、/homeに設定を保持したという意味でもあります。

答え3

これらはすべてSambaで提供されていますか?たとえば、適切だと言いたいです/srv/smb/music

~によるとFHS

/ srvには、このシステムによって提供されるサイト固有のデータが含まれています。

基本的な

これの主な目的は、ユーザーが特定のサービスのデータファイルの場所を見つけることを可能にすることです。したがって、読み取り専用データ、書き込み可能データ、およびスクリプト(CGIスクリプトなど)を格納するために単一のツリーを必要とするサービスが可能です。適切に配置されました。特定のユーザーが関心のあるデータのみが、そのユーザーのホームディレクトリに保存する必要があります。

/ srvサブディレクトリの名前を指定するために使用される方法は、現在これを行う方法について合意がないため、指定されません。 / srvでデータを構造化する1つの方法は、プロトコルを使用することです。 ftp、rsync、www、cvs。大規模システムでは、/srv/physicals/www、/srv/compsci/cvsなどの管理コンテキストを使用して/ srvを構築するのが便利です。この設定はホストによって異なります。したがって、どのプログラムも/ srvの特定の既存のサブディレクトリ構造や/ srvに必ず格納されるデータに依存してはいけません。ただし、/ srvはFHS互換システムに常に存在し、そのデータのデフォルトの場所として使用する必要があります。

Distrosは、管理者権限なしでこれらのディレクトリにローカルに配置されたファイルを削除しないように注意する必要があります。

答え4

それでは、他の人が同じインストールにアクセスできるようにしたいですか?標準の場所は/mnt、/opt、/mnt/mediaです。あるいは、ループバックマウントを/home//に設定することもできます。さまざまなオプションがあり、必要なものは何でもできます。

個人的にセキュリティ上の問題や他の問題がない限り、別のログインを使用することは愚かなことだと思います。

関連情報